Black-Owned Tour Companies Surge, Empowering Travelers
The travel industry is witnessing a surge in Black-owned tour companies, catering specifically to the needs and experiences of Black travelers. These companies not only provide safe spaces for exploration but also foster a strong sense of community and encourage authentic cultural connections.
Dipaways, founded by Dricks Everette, stands out as a luxury group travel company dedicated to the Black travel community. It aims to create connections and a sense of belonging among Black travelers. Similarly, Nomadness Travel Tribe, established by Evita Robinson, has evolved from an online community to a global travel collective with thousands of members. It focuses on global citizenship and cultural exchange.
Black Girls Travel Too (BGTT), an international travel club empowering millennial Black women, creates immersive cultural experiences. Luxe Tribes, founded by Chidi Ashley, specializes in curating group travel meet-ups and private experiences for Black travelers while supporting local communities. Up In The Air Life, founded by Claire Soares, is a boutique travel agency that empowers Black travelers to travel confidently among like-minded individuals.
